Защитите Excel Excel для формата и размера и разрешите только для ввода - PullRequest
5 голосов
/ 08 октября 2008

Я создаю рабочий лист XLS, который будет использоваться для сбора данных от пользователей. Я ограничил ввод пользователя с помощью проверок. Для того, чтобы можно было легко распечатать рабочий лист, я установил длину столбцов. Сделали соответствующие столбцы обернуть. Однако я хотел бы защитить лист так, чтобы Пользователь не может 1. Измените формат 2. Изменить проверки 3. Измените размер столбца Пользователь должен иметь возможность 1. Введите входные значения 2. Выберите значение (из выпадающего списка, где применимо)

Защитный лист всегда ограничивает вводимые пользователем данные.

Ответы [ 2 ]

3 голосов
/ 08 октября 2008

Ключ - , после вы защищаете лист, чтобы использовать интерфейс, представленный в «Разрешить пользователям редактировать диапазоны». Я предполагаю, что вы используете Office 2003, поскольку вы не указали, поэтому вы найдете его в Сервис -> Защита -> Разрешить пользователям редактировать диапазоны .

Оттуда это должно быть довольно очевидно - вы создаете именованные диапазоны и предоставляете пользователям доступ для редактирования на основе этого.

Во втором вопросе, когда пользователи выбирают значения из комбинированных полей, вы контролируете это с помощью Данные -> Проверка. затем создайте пользовательский список.

0 голосов
/ 08 октября 2008

Обычно, когда вы защищаете лист, вы получаете диалоговое окно, которое позволяет вам выбирать, что пользователи могут и не могут делать. Если вы выберете правильные варианты, вы сможете делать то, что вы хотите.

Посмотрите эту запись в блоге для более подробной информации.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...